    Interesting, although I don't think it's fair to label it as a rival to Oxbridge. It appears that it's going to be private, very much like those in the US, so I'm guessing it won't be following the general UCAS system, as the cap on fees is £9,000 as opposed to the £18,000 asking price here. I also think that Oxbridge has a wealth of history, stemming back over 900 years and of course, this "new college" is lacking that nostalgia.

    The critics couldn't be more correct about creating a wider gap between the general public and the elite, though.
